Transaction 340d510b421c0247e6183fd63a61238834a63023a0a24c0fe3817230a1bf7590

1 Input
1 Outputs
  • 340d510b421c0247e6183fd63a61238834a63023a0a24c0fe3817230a1bf7590:0
  • value  3794417
    address  3NEyR2NzpTrRogCoHzqRa46njcH2urENWh